It is insulation material for the "blown-in method" with stable and reliable quality.
A blowing method that uses a dedicated machine to blow in granular glass wool specifically designed for ceiling insulation into the ceiling space. It is ideal for installing insulation material without gaps in complex ceiling spaces filled with hanging wood, wiring, and uneven surfaces.

【Features】 ○ It has been treated to prevent dust and static electricity generation, allowing for stable construction. ○ The load on the ceiling is based on the standard density at the time of construction multiplied by the design thickness (kg/m2). ○ It is non-combustible due to its inorganic materials. ● For more details, please contact us or refer to the catalog.

Paramount Glass Industry began its operations over 60 years ago in 1946. Three years later, it succeeded in the industrial production of glass wool for the first time in Japan. Since then, it has consistently led the industry as a pioneer in insulation materials. Since its founding, our corporate philosophy has been to "contribute to society and the environment by providing insulation products," a principle that has been passed down unchanged from the past to the present. Especially in terms of the environment, glass wool itself is a material that directly contributes to CO2 reduction, and there is no doubt that the demand for it will continue to grow.
